Why KOSPI moves so violently: two chip stocks, half the market, and 10x leverage
Samsung and SK Hynix are now nearly half of KOSPI, single stocks can swing 30% in a day, and Korean retail investors trade with leverage tools that go up to 10 times their money. Here is how those three things combine into one of the world's most violent stock markets.
